Get Started in Guitar is a fresh guide to learning guitar, written and supported by Rockschool, the UK's only teaching body for rock, pop and country musicians of all ages and abilities. It explains which type of guitar to play, what model suits you best and the basic playing techniques before introducing rhythms, chords, riffs and melodies and showing you how to combine them all together. Punctuated by practical exercises and featuring an audio CD to show you how it all works, this is an essential guide for all those who want to play modern popular music on guitar for their own pleasure but don't know where to start.
